When should you go for small dining tables?

Small dining tables can help out in a situation where the total guest change from minute to minute; move then in and move them out or just add a couple of chairs.  Then just making them can be as fun as the use; take a quick card table or any folding table and move it in.  Place a nice table cloth over it and a pretty center piece on top of almost anything and it can look great.

Decorations

On a small table it is best to keep the place setting as simple as is attractive and the center piece very small if at all.  Just a pretty little candle a name plate designation or single flower may be more than enough to make it personable.  Place mats are best to be left out using only the utensils and a napkin to mark an individual spot.  Keep the decorative serving wear to a minimum also as these can lead to a cluttered look.  A table cloth and something simple in the middle of the table can allow for a buffet setting where only the needed dishes and utensils are brought to the table by your guests.  Chips and such may be also left to the individual to bring from the buffet to the table to allow for more room on the table; then cleared when the main course is being served.  Just rotating the courses can make it seem as there is more area or space than there really is.

Tables

Smaller tables can be created from almost anything that you can dream up.  From a quick card table or a folding table it really is up to you and how you present it.  A table can be just an end table or cocktail table set in just the right fashion.  Something as simple as a piece of wood placed over a couple of milk crates or bails or hay can work in a country setting.  Or using resources and renting some additional small tables from a store can allow for you to be present and be prepared for any amount of extra guests and still appear fashionable and as if you knew this was going to happen the whole time.

Prepare

If there may be occasion for the possibilities of extra guests: many more than planned.  Just learn to plan ahead and know that you might need extra room.  Maybe even an outside area with some cover and climate control or a room inside emptied to allow for a quick set up.  Having the additional tables and of course chairs can make short notice almost looked planned.  Just plan for the unknown and you can never go wrong.

Stop the stress. Plan a bit ahead for any possibility and go with the flow.  Your guests will see your stress if you allow it or just as easily see that everything is fine and you have the philosophy that the more the merrier is great as long as everyone has a great time and would want to join you for another evening at any time.
